原文アブストラクト
The integration of emerging uncrewed aerial vehicles (UAVs) with artificial intelligence (AI) and ground-embedded robots (GERs) has transformed emergency rescue operations in unknown environments. However, the high computational demands often exceed a single UAV's capacity, making it difficult to continuously provide stable high-level services. To address this, this paper proposes a cooperation framework involving UAVs, GERs, and airships. The framework enables resource pooling through UAV-to-GER (U2G) and UAV-to-airship (U2A) links, offering computing services for offloaded tasks. Specifically, we formulate the multi-objective problem of task assignment and exploration as a dynamic long-term optimization problem aiming to minimize task completion time and energy use while ensuring stability. Using Lyapunov optimization, we transform it into a per-slot deterministic problem and propose HG-MADDPG, which combines the Hungarian algorithm with a GDM-based multi-agent deep deterministic policy gradient. Simulations demonstrate significant improvements in offloading efficiency, latency, and system stability over baselines.
